Technical Field
The utility model belongs to the technical field of fitness equipment, and particularly relates to a support for a horizontal bar on a door.
Background
The horizontal bar on the door is widely used as a household body-building apparatus because of small occupied space and convenient exercise. With the improvement of living standard of people and the importance of body building training, the use of door frame horizontal bars is becoming more popular. The horizontal bar on the door of prior art mostly includes the telescopic link and sets up the supporting seat at the telescopic link both ends, mainly makes the supporting seat extrusion wall produce frictional force through the telescopic link extension and fixes when using, although can play the fixed action to a certain extent, but when the bearing is heavier and heavier or at the in-process of user's motion, the horizontal bar on the door bearing can be greater than the frictional force between supporting seat and the wall, leads to the horizontal bar to drop on the door, causes the potential safety hazard.

Example 1
Referring to fig. 1 to 4, the present embodiment provides a supporter for a horizontal bar on a door, including a supporting main body, one end of the supporting main body is provided with a supporting seat 1 for supporting the horizontal bar on the door, the other end of the supporting main body is provided with a connecting seat 2 for connecting the horizontal bar 8 on the door, the supporting seat 1 is provided with a supporting portion 5 for leaning against a door frame, the supporting portion 5 includes an extended state and a contracted state relative to the supporting seat 1, and the supporting seat 1 is provided with a position switching component for switching the supporting portion 5 between the extended state and the contracted state.
When the supporting portion 5 in the embodiment is in the extending state, the supporting portion 5 is far away from the supporting seat 1, so that the end face of the supporting portion 5 is abutted against the door frame, and the supporting seat 1 can support the horizontal bar 8 on the door; in the contracted state, the supporting part 5 is displaced towards the supporting seat 1, so that the supporting part 5 is separated from and abutted against the door frame, and the upper horizontal bar 8 of the door is conveniently detached from the door frame.
The support 5 described in this embodiment is provided with a non-slip mat on the side that is intended to rest against the door frame.
Referring to fig. 3, in this embodiment, the position switching assembly is within the scope of the present utility model as long as the position switching assembly can switch the supporting portion 5 between the extended state and the retracted state. For example, the position switching assembly includes an elastic expansion member provided between the support base 1 and the support portion 5; and a limiting device for enabling the elastic telescopic piece to be in a compressed state is further arranged between the supporting seat 1 and the supporting part 5. By arranging the limiting device, the elastic telescopic piece is always in a compressed state, and when the supporting part of the compressed elastic telescopic piece is in an extending state and is abutted against the door frame, the compressed elastic telescopic piece can stably support the horizontal bar on the door; the limiting device can also prevent the supporting part from falling off the supporting seat when in an extending state.
The elastic telescopic member is a spring 6, and the spring 6 is arranged between the supporting seat 1 and the supporting part 5. The resilient telescoping members described in this embodiment include, but are not limited to, springs.
Referring to fig. 1, this embodiment provides a specific implementation manner of a limiting device, where the limiting device includes a limiting hole 10 and a limiting block 9 slidably disposed in the limiting hole, the limiting hole 10 is disposed on the supporting seat 1, the limiting block 9 is disposed on the supporting portion 5, and the elastic expansion member is always in a compressed state through cooperation of the limiting block 9 and the limiting hole 10.
The limiting block 9 is fixedly connected with the supporting portion 5, four limiting holes 10 can be further formed in the supporting seat 1, the four limiting holes 10 are symmetrically formed in the left side surface and the right side surface of the supporting seat 1 in pairs, and four limiting blocks 9 corresponding to the four limiting holes 10 are arranged on the supporting portion 5.
Referring to fig. 2 and 3, on the basis of the above-mentioned scheme, the position switching assembly further includes a control assembly, where the control assembly is configured to drive the support portion 5 to displace toward the support base 1, thereby compressing the elastic expansion member, and switching the support portion 5 to a contracted state.
The control assembly in this embodiment is only capable of realizing the function of driving the support portion 5 to displace toward the support base 1 to compress the elastic expansion member and switch the support portion 5 to the contracted state, which falls within the scope of the present utility model. For example, the control component is a cam wrench 4, the cam wrench 4 is arranged on the supporting seat 1 and is connected with the supporting part 5 through a connecting rod 7, the cam wrench 4 comprises a locking state and an unlocking state, and a locking groove 11 for enabling the cam wrench 4 to be in the locking state is arranged on the supporting seat 1;
when the cam wrench 4 is in a locking state, the cam wrench 4 drives the supporting part 5 to move towards the supporting seat 1 and compresses the elastic telescopic piece to enable the supporting part 5 to be in a contracted state; when the pulling cam wrench 4 is in the unlocking state, the supporting part 5 is far away from the supporting seat 1 under the action of the elastic telescopic piece, and the supporting part 5 is in the extending state. The cam spanner 4 is hinged on the connecting rod 7 through a pin shaft. When the cam wrench 4 drives the supporting portion 5 to displace toward the supporting seat 1 and compresses the elastic telescopic member to enable the supporting portion 5 to be in a contracted state, the compressed elastic telescopic member has a resetting trend at the moment, so that the locking groove 11 is provided to lock the cam wrench 4 in the locking groove 11, and automatic resetting of the elastic telescopic member is prevented.
Referring to fig. 2 and 4, on the basis of any one of the above schemes, the supporting body is a supporting rod 3, one end of the supporting rod 3 is fixedly connected with the supporting seat 1, and the other end of the supporting rod 3 is fixedly connected with the connecting seat 2. When the supporting seat 1 is used for supporting the horizontal bar 8 on the door, the supporting seat 1 is arranged below the horizontal bar 8 on the door and supports the horizontal bar 8 on the door through the supporting rod 3 which is inclined upwards. At least a part of the locking groove 11 may also be provided on the support bar 3.
In this embodiment, the connection base 2 may be a hoop. The anchor ear comprises a left half anchor ear and a right half anchor ear, the left half anchor ear is fixedly connected to the supporting main body, and the right half anchor ear is hinged to the left half anchor ear; the left half anchor ear and the right half anchor ear are combined to form a circular anchor ear and are fastened through bolts.
The following is further described in connection with the working principle:
referring to fig. 1 to 4, when the supporter for a horizontal bar on a door according to the present embodiment is used, the supporters are respectively disposed at the left and right ends of the horizontal bar on the door, the connecting base 2 is first connected to the horizontal bar 8 on the door, and after the supporting ends at the two ends of the horizontal bar 8 on the door are adjusted, the connecting base is adjusted to a proper position. Wherein, adjust the supporting seat 1 to the below of horizontal bar 8 on the door, and the supporting seat 1 is connected to horizontal bar on the door through the bracing piece 3 that inclines upwards, can make supporting seat 1 form firm support to horizontal bar 8 on the door. Then, the cam wrench 4 (the cam wrench is arranged in the locking groove by default) is pulled to enable the cam wrench 4 to be in an unlocking state, at the moment, the supporting part 5 is far away from the supporting seat 1 under the action of the elastic telescopic piece, the supporting part 5 in the extending state is in an extending state, and the supporting part 5 in the extending state is firmly abutted against the door frame under the action of the elastic telescopic piece, so that the horizontal bar 8 on the door is strongly supported, and the force born by the horizontal bar 8 on the door is increased.
When the door upper horizontal bar 8 is taken off from the door frame, the cam wrench 4 is pulled into the locking groove 11 to enable the cam wrench 4 to be in a locking state, and at the moment, the cam wrench 4 drives the supporting portion 5 to move towards the supporting seat 1 and compresses the elastic telescopic piece to enable the supporting portion 5 to be in a contracted state, and the supporting portion 5 in the contracted state is separated from the door frame.
Example two
Referring to fig. 5, in this embodiment, on the basis of the first embodiment, unlike the first embodiment, the position switching assembly includes a telescopic rod 13 and a driving member 12, one end of the telescopic rod 13 is fixedly connected to the supporting portion 5, the other end of the telescopic rod 13 is fixedly connected to the driving member 12, and the driving member 12 is used for driving the telescopic rod 13 to be in an extended state or a contracted state. The driving member 12 drives the telescopic rod 13 to be in an extended state, thereby putting the supporting portion 5 in an extended state, and drives the telescopic rod 13 to be in a contracted state, thereby putting the supporting portion 5 in a contracted state. The driving member 12 is fixedly arranged in the supporting seat 1. The driving member 12 may be any of an electric cylinder, an air cylinder, or a hydraulic cylinder.
